No, there is no direct train from Grendon to London Stansted Airport (STN). However, there are services departing from Wellingborough and arriving at Stansted Airport via King's Cross St. Pancras station and Tottenham Hale.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 8m.
The distance between Grendon and London Stansted Airport (STN) is 108 miles. The road distance is 60.5 miles.
